Fabio Carrera '84

Fabio Carrera, your years of leadership, creativity and vision have resulted in the success of the WPI Venice Project Center, where more than 75 projects, involving more than 250 students, have been carried out, providing Venetian organizations with invaluable results to assist in addressing the city's environmental, social and cultural preservation challenges.

Testimony to the quality of the support you have provided is the long series of President's IQP Awards that have been garnered by student projects completed in Venice--projects that you have designed, co-advised and marketed. Your dedication and commitment have provided WPI and its students with opportunities to explore the interaction of science, technology and society, while learning about themselves and their place in the world. Without your vision, which led to the founding of the project center in 1988, WPI could not have taken its place in the history of the preservation of Venice.

Fabio Carrera, it is with pleasure that we recognize your commitment to WPI and to your native city by presenting you with the John Boynton Young Alumni Award for Service to WPI.

Deborah Harrow '84

Deb Harrow, your years of volunteer leadership have distinguished you among young alumni. From your involvement in the Alumni Admissions Program to your current post of chair of your class's 15th Reunion Gift Committee, your efforts have served to bring students and alumni closer to WPI.

Your loyalty to WPI began during your undergraduate years, when you were involved with the Social Committee, the Interfraternity Council and the Orientation Committee. You also served your class as president. Since graduation, your active leadership as a member of the Executive Committee and the Master Plan Committee has helped shape the future of the Alumni Association. As a loyal supporter of your class, you served generously as a member of the class board of directors, a class agent and a Reunion volunteer.

Deb Harrow, your valuable insights and engaging demeanor have made you an apt leader and an honored friend. It is with great pleasure that we present to you today the John Boynton Young Alumni Award for Service to WPI.
